Rumah > pangkalan data > tutorial mysql > Bagaimana untuk Menukar Jadual MySQL kepada Senarai Kamus dalam Python menggunakan mysqldb?

Bagaimana untuk Menukar Jadual MySQL kepada Senarai Kamus dalam Python menggunakan mysqldb?

Mary-Kate Olsen
Lepaskan: 2024-11-19 10:49:02
asal
261 orang telah melayarinya

How to Convert a MySQL Table to a List of Dictionaries in Python using mysqldb?

Python: Menukar Jadual MySQL kepada Senarai Objek Kamus menggunakan mysqldb

Untuk mengubah jadual MySQL menjadi senarai objek kamus dalam Python, anda boleh menggunakan kelas DictCursor yang disediakan oleh perpustakaan mysqldb. Dengan memanfaatkan kelas kursor ini, anda boleh menukar setiap baris dalam jadual dengan mudah kepada kamus yang sepadan.

Untuk menggunakan DictCursor, ikut langkah berikut:

  1. Sambung ke Pangkalan Data MySQL:
    Mewujudkan sambungan ke pangkalan data MySQL menggunakan kaedah connect() MySQLdb modul.
  2. Buat Kursor dengan DictCursor:
    Nyatakan kelas kursor DictCursor apabila mencipta objek kursor menggunakan parameter kelas kursor. Kelas kursor ini secara automatik akan mengembalikan baris sebagai kamus dan bukannya tupel.
  3. Laksanakan Pertanyaan:
    Laksanakan pertanyaan SQL untuk mendapatkan semula data daripada jadual.
  4. Ambil Semua Baris:
    Gunakan kaedah fetchall() objek kursor untuk mendapatkan semula semua rekod daripada hasil pertanyaan.

Dengan mengikut langkah ini, anda boleh menukar jadual MySQL kepada senarai objek kamus dengan berkesan, memudahkan manipulasi dan pemprosesan data dalam Python.

Atas ialah kandungan terperinci Bagaimana untuk Menukar Jadual MySQL kepada Senarai Kamus dalam Python menggunakan mysqldb?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

sumber:php.cn
Kenyataan Laman Web ini
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n
Artikel terbaru oleh pengarang
Tutorial Popular
Lagi>
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an